Employees at a Florida weather station experienced a tornado live on air during an intense broadcast caught on camera.
Video taken by the tower camera on top of Orlando's FOX 35 television station shows winds from a tornado barreling toward the broadcaster while the team was covering the twister live on air.
A television meteorologist broadcast live on the air as a tornado hit his station's studio in Lake Mary, Florida, near Orlando. The meteorologist, Brooks Garner, warned employees to take shelter.
